Laws of Minnesota 1991
CHAPTER 86-H.F.No. 1396
An act relating to local government; allowing Pine
county to transfer money from the county welfare fund
to the general fund to support a hospital.
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F MINNESOTA:
Section 1. [PINE COUNTY FUNDS TRANSFER.]
Pine county may transfer $100,000 from the county welfare
fund to the county general fund to reimburse the general fund
for money paid in calendar year 1989 to the North Pine Area
Hospital District. The money transferred under this section may
be derived from the levy of the county under Minnesota Statutes,
section 275.50, subdivision 5, paragraph (a), for social
services and income maintenance programs.
Sec. 2. [PENALTY WAIVED.]
No penalty may be imposed under Minnesota Statutes, section
275.55, subdivision 1, with respect to a transfer of money from
the county welfare fund under section 1.
Sec. 3. [EFFECTIVE DATE.]
This act is effective the day following final enactment
without local approval as provided under Minnesota Statutes,
section 645.023, subdivision 1, clause (a).
Presented to the governor May 10, 1991
Signed by the governor May 14, 1991, 3:25 p.m.
